Overview

Marin Community Clinics – Marin County, CA

Marin Community Clinics (MCC), founded in 1972, is a multi‑clinic network providing comprehensive, integrated care across Marin County. As a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C), we deliver high‑quality primary care, dental, behavioral health, specialty, and referral services to nearly 40,000 individuals each year. MCC is nationally recognized and regularly receives awards from the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A).

The Pediatrician provides quality primary care to patients of Marin Community Clinics consistent with her/his training and expertise, and appropriate to the ambulatory care setting provided.

Responsibilities
  • Provides comprehensive outpatient pediatric primary care.
  • Cares for pediatric patients (ages 0-18 years old).
  • Conducts routine well-child care visits, urgent care and follow up appointments.
  • Provides supervision and consultation to mid-level pediatric practitioners working at the clinic.
  • Opportunity to conduct pediatric inpatient hospital rounds at Marin General Hospital based on need and interest.
  • Participates in quality management activities as assigned by the Medical Director.
  • Participates in the direction and development of health care services provided by Marin Community Clinics as a member of the primary health care team.
  • In addition to regularly scheduled shifts, is able to work a minimum of three (3) 4‑hour Saturday shifts per calendar year, providing medical care to patients within the standard scope of practice. Requirement begins after 90‑day training period and compensation for coverage to be outlined in offer.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Qualifications

Education and Experience:

  • Pediatrician with experience preferred but new residency grads also welcome or Pediatric NP with 3+ yrs. of experience.
  • Board eligible or Board certified highly preferred.
  • Must have a valid and unrestricted license issued by the Medical Board of California to practice medicine.
  • Current registration issued by the DEA allowing the prescription of drugs.
  • Current BLS certification.
  • Prior experience working with under‑served communities in a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C) Community Health Clinic environment highly desirable.
  • Experience with EPIC Electronic Health Records preferred.

Required Skills and Abilities:

  • Ability to see an average of 18-22 patients per day for Full Time shift.
  • Bilingual English/Spanish is highly desired.
  • Ability to work both independently and in a team environment.

Physical Requirements and Working Conditions:

  • Prolonged standing, walking, and prolonged periods sitting at desk and working on a computer.
  • Must be able to lift up to 25 pounds at times and move medical equipment.
  • Fine motor hand movements typical of performing standard Pediatrician job duties.
  • Able to read charts graphs and readings on medical equipment.
